Church to Offer 'Ashes to Go' on Orange Line

St. George's Episcopal Church to assist busy commuters at Virginia Square Metro; see where else to get ashes Wednesday in Vienna.

Busy Catholics in Vienna and beyond who are traveling the Orange Line on Wednesday can get their ashes to go. 

A group from St. George’s Episcopal Church in Arlington will be distributing ashes in the Virginia Square Metro Plaza for Ash Wednesday, according to a news release from the church. 

Ash Wednesday marks the beginning of Lent.

If you travel from Vienna on the Orange Line, or work near the station, representatives of the church will offer the ashes to anyone who wants them from 8:30 to 9:30 a.m. and from 5:30 to 6:30 p.m.

One does not have to be a particular religion to receive the ashes.
